A surfactant is the most important part of any cleaning agent. The word surfactant is short for “Surface Active Agent.” In general, they are chemicals that, when dissolved in water or another solvent, orient themselves at the interface (boundary) between the liquid and a solid (the dirt we are removing), and modify the properties of the interface.
XI-Detergents-A-Soap-2 The Chemistry of Soap and Detergent Function All soaps and detergents contain a surfactant1 as their active ingredient. This is an ionic species consisting of a long, linear, non-polar ’tail’ with a cationic or anionic ’head’ and a counter ion.

Application of Solubility: Soaps. Carboxylic acids and salts having alkyl chains longer than eight carbons exhibit unusual behavior in water due to the presence of both hydrophilic (CO 2) and hydrophobic (alkyl) regions in the same molecule. Such molecules are termed amphiphilic (Gk. amphi = both) or amphipathic.

Soaps are sodium or potassium fatty acids salts, produced from the hydrolysis of fats in a chemical reaction called saponification. Dec 05, 2017·How soap works is due to its unique chemistry, the hydrophilic (loves water) and hydrophobic (hates water) parts of soap act to combine soapy water with grease, dirt, or oil. This combination creates clusters of soap, water, and grime called micelles. Soap is a product that most of us use every day, yet most of us also don’t know exactly how ...
